Three people perish in Eor- Ekule’s semi-trailer accident

4th June, 2015

At least three people have been confirmed dead after a semi-trailer they were travelling in crashed against guard rails near a bridge at Eor-Ekule in Narok. The accident which occurred at around 5:30 am involved a semi-trailer ferrying flour from the Pembe flour millers company in Nairobi to Narok. The area has seen several fatal accidents due to a steep gradient leading to the bridge. Narok police county commander Abdi Galgalo has cautioned drivers using the Mai Mahiu Narok road to be careful and observe the roads signage to avoid such accidents. He also called on the highways authorities to help cover several deep potholes around the black spots in Ntulele and Eore-Kule to reduce accidents in the area.
